Automobile wire harness detection device
Technical Field
The utility model relates to the technical field of automobile wire harness processing, in particular to an automobile wire harness detection device.
Background
In modern automobiles, automobile wire harnesses are particularly large, an electronic control system has close relation with the wire harnesses, the automobile wire harnesses are network main bodies of automobile circuits, electric and electronic components of the automobiles are connected and are enabled to function, no automobile circuits exist without the wire harnesses, the types of electronic products on the automobiles are continuously increased along with the continuous improvement of requirements of people on comfort, economy and safety, the automobile wire harnesses are more and more complex, and the detection of the automobile wire harnesses is more and more important.
In the wire harness production process, the connector terminal is not inserted in place or is retracted, and partial function failure of the whole vehicle is easily caused. These problems are not solved, have the potential safety hazard easily, seriously influence vehicle wholeness ability, make the terminal insert the connector earlier in the testing process of pencil after, the staff carries out the action of one and inserts two sound three pullbacks and peg graft, and in order to guarantee to detect more accurately and still can carry out twice or three times detects, and repeated mechanical work is higher for staff's intensity, and detection efficiency is lower.
An automobile harness detection device is required to solve this problem.

Detailed Description
The following describes the embodiments of the present utility model in further detail with reference to the drawings.
Examples:
the utility model is given by fig. 1, which comprises a fixed frame body 1, the downside of the fixed frame body 1 is movably connected with a clamping plate, the upper end of the fixed frame body 1 is provided with a track 2, the track 2 is connected with a first sliding block 3 and a second sliding block 4 in a sliding way, the first sliding block 3 and the second sliding block 4 are provided with detection devices with opposite directions, each detection device comprises a support frame 5 fixedly connected with the first sliding block 3 and the second sliding block 4, the support frame 5 is provided with a horizontal fixed cylinder 6, an electric push rod 7 is arranged in the fixed cylinder 6, one end of the electric push rod 7 is fixedly arranged on the support frame 5, the other end of the electric push rod 7 is provided with a contact 8, the upper side and the lower side of the fixed cylinder 6 are also provided with a first guide rail 9 and a second guide rail 10 which are respectively arranged on the support frame 5, the first clamping jaw 11 and the second clamping jaw 12 are respectively arranged on the first guide rail 9 and the second guide rail 10, a clamping block 13 which faces the fixed cylinder 6 is provided with the same direction as the structure of the first clamping jaw 11, and a driving mechanism which drives the first clamping jaw 11 and the second clamping jaw 12 to move towards the fixed cylinder 6 or away from the fixed cylinder 6 simultaneously is arranged on the support frame 5.
The driving mechanism comprises a mounting seat 14 arranged on the supporting frame 5, a bidirectional screw rod 15 is rotatably arranged on the mounting seat 14, a first connecting plate 16 and a second connecting plate 17 are respectively arranged on the first clamping jaw 11 and the second clamping jaw 12, the first connecting plate 16 and the second connecting plate 17 are respectively in threaded connection with the upper end and the lower end of the bidirectional screw rod 15, and the first clamping jaw 11 and the second clamping jaw 12 can simultaneously move towards the direction of the fixed cylinder 6 or simultaneously are far away from the fixed cylinder 6 through rotating the bidirectional screw rod 15.
The upper end and the lower end of the fixed cylinder 6 are provided with through grooves corresponding to the clamping blocks 13.
The upper end of the bidirectional screw rod 15 is also provided with a handle 19.
The clamping plate comprises a first straight plate 20, detachable second straight plates 21 are arranged on the left side and the right side of the first straight plate 20, and the two second straight plates 21 are respectively and movably connected with the left end and the right end of the fixed frame body 1.
The left end and the right end of the fixing frame body 1 are rotatably connected with vertical one-way screw rods 22, the lower ends of the one-way screw rods 22 are in threaded connection with the second straight plates 21, the left end and the right end of the fixing frame body 1 are further provided with vertical positioning rods 23, and the positioning rods 23 penetrate through the second straight plates 21 and are in sliding connection with the second straight plates 21.
The lower side of the fixing frame body 1 and the upper side of the clamping plate are also provided with an anti-slip pad 24.
The mounting seat 14 is also provided with a driving motor, a first gear is arranged on a rotating shaft of the driving motor, and the bidirectional screw rod 15 is provided with a second gear meshed with the first gear.
The two contacts 8 are respectively connected with an external power supply and a connector.
When the wire harness detection device is used, the positions of the first straight plate 20 and the second straight plate 21 are adjusted through rotating the one-way screw 22 according to a detected field, the fixed frame body 1 is fixedly installed at a fixed position through the first straight plate 20 or the second straight plate 21 and the fixed frame body 1, the position between the two supporting frames 5 is adjusted according to the length of a wire harness to be detected, one end of the wire harness is placed into one of the fixed cylinders 6, after the two-way screw 15 is rotated through a manual rotating pair or a driving motor, the clamping blocks 13 on the two clamping plates enter the fixed cylinders 6 through grooves to clamp the wire harness, the other end of the wire harness can be placed into the other fixed cylinder 6 at the moment, the contact 8 is pushed by the electric push rod 7 to be connected with the wire harness for testing, and the contact 8 can be driven by the electric push rod 7 to contact and separate with the wire harness for multiple times for multiple detection.
